How E.l.f. Beauty’s Sponsored Hashtag Got 1.6 Billion Views On TikTok – And Counting

If TikTok is still proving its value as a marketing platform, despite skyrocketing popularity among Gen Z, it got a huge boost in October when the cosmetics company e.l.f. ran a sponsored hashtag challenge, #eyeslipsface, that amassed 1.6 billion views in just over a week. Spotify Helps Bring Me the Horizon Fans Customize Their T-Shirts

Grammy Award-nominated Sony Music Entertainment artists Bring Me the Horizon are adding a dash of Spotify to the process of enabling their fans to purchase customized T-shirts.
